About Me:
Hi! My name is Amelia Gil-Figueroa and I am currently a first year Masters student studying Vocal Performance
at Peabody Conservatory in Baltimore, MD.
During my undergraduate years at George Mason University, I found out about La Musica Lirica - a five week summer program in beautiful Novafeltria, Italy -that focuses on providing training and performance opportunities to young singers seeking to grow in their artistic abilities. While I was unable to attend in my Mason years, this year I have been offered the opportunity to cover (or understudy) the role of Donna Elvira in their production of Don Giovanni by W.A. Mozart.
While there, I will have weekly opera coachings, voice lessons, and Italian language classes, participating in master classes and staging of the opera. At the end of the program, I will be able to perform a piano run of Don Giovanni along with all the other covers! I believe this will be a wonderful opportunity for me in my future career.
